Natural Remedies For Anxiety Disorder

Anxiety is a natural emotion that can drive you to prepare for an exam or prepare for an interview. If it becomes too overwhelming or affects your daily life, you should seek treatment.

Natural therapies and remedies are effective in relieving anxiety for many people. They can be used in conjunction with or as a replacement for traditional treatments.

Ashwagandha

Ashwagandha is a plant well-known for its natural properties to reduce anxiety. It has been used for centuries in Ayurvedic Medicine to boost mood and increase energy levels. It also reduces anxiety-related symptoms, including sweating, nervousness and rapid heartbeat. This herb is gaining popularity in the United States as a natural anxiety treatment. It may also have antioxidant effects and increase the brain's activity.

In a study from 2022 scientists looked at data from seven randomized studies on the use of ashwagandha in order to reduce anxiety and stress. They found that participants taking Ashwagandha had lower scores on anxiety and stress and their levels of cortisol were significantly reduced. Researchers concluded that ashwagandha is effective at reducing anxiety and stress, but they suggested longer trials and further research to better understand the herb's effectiveness.

Ashwagandha can be found in supplement form at most health food stores. Ashwagandha can be found in powder, capsules, or liquid extracts. It is simple to add the plant to your diet. However, you should consult your healthcare provider before adding it to your daily routine. This will aid you in determining the right dosage for your needs and ensure that it doesn't cross-react with any medications or conditions you have.

Ashwagandha is generally believed to be safe, but it can affect thyroid hormones. It may not be suitable for women who are pregnant or nursing mothers. If taken in large quantities, it could cause adverse effects, including liver issues. It is important to choose an established brand and consume the recommended amount of the supplement to reduce the risk.

Ashwagandha is a well-known herb that can ease symptoms of anxiety such as nervousness, fatigue, and low sexual desire. It is also renowned for increasing the level of libido and boosting energy. It is usually taken together with other supplements like valerian root or kava in order to boost its effects. It is an adaptogenic plant which means it assists the body cope with stress by assisting normal physiological processes.

Chamomile

Chamomile is a herb that has been used as a medicinal plant for a long time. It is part of the daisy (Asteraceae) family and is found throughout the world. The herb has been utilized for centuries to help promote relaxation, reduce anxiety and ease stomach pain. It is also used to treat skin problems and reduce pain. The essential oil of chamomile that contains the apigenin chemical, is thought to be the reason for its calming properties. However, further research is required to determine if chamomile may be anxiolytic in humans.

Chamomile can be found in herbal supplements and teas. Herbal supplements are not regulated by the FDA like medications and some herbs could interact with certain medications. Before you take any herbal supplements it is crucial to consult your physician.

Kava

Kava, a plant-based relaxant popular with Pacific Islanders, may be capable of helping ease anxiety disorder symptoms. According to a recent study, Kava can reduce stress and anxiety among people who suffer from generalized anxiety disorders. The study adds further evidence that kava is an effective short-term treatment for anxiety disorders. A controlled study that was randomized gave 75 participants either kava or a placebo over six weeks. In the course of the study, the kava supplement was more effective than a control in the reduction of anxiety. Kava also had no side effects, such as headaches or stomachaches.

Researchers have proposed that kava works by inhibiting the action of an enzyme that breaks down neurotransmitters. These neurotransmitters include norepinephrine and dopamine. Norepinephrine helps regulate blood pressure, increases levels of energy and improves mood.

The researchers also pointed out that kava is believed to act on the anterior cingulate cortex (ACC). This brain region is responsible for the processing of affective, cognitive and emotional information, as well as the suppression of negative emotions or cognitions. The ACC is linked to the autonomic system, and scientists believe that kava may influence this system.

A small clinical trial found that kava was effective in treating anxiety however, it is not recommended for long-term use. Some studies have also reported liver damage in people taking supplements with kava. Consult your doctor before taking Kava to treat anxiety.

In addition to helping to relax the mind, kava can aid in improving sleep. People usually mix kava with water or boil it to make it easier to drink. It is also available in capsule form. It is crucial to follow the dosage instructions carefully to avoid liver toxicities. Certain kava products also contain passion flower, a different herb that can cause liver issues. Therefore, it is recommended to consult a physician before using any herbal product to treat anxiety. Talk to your doctor if you are pregnant or nursing.

Melatonin

Melatonin, which is best known as a sleep aid and is recommended for insomniacs, may also help to reduce anxiety. There is evidence that suggests melatonin is a powerful anti-anxiety medication because it can increase levels of the neurotransmitter gamma aminobutyric acid (GABA) in certain parts of the brain. This could result in a calming effect similar to that of prescription drugs like Ativan and Xanax that work by altering GABA receptors in the brain. In a study of animals, melatonin reduced anxiety by increasing oxytocin levels serotonin levels, serotonin levels and noradrenaline, and reducing the expression of a protein that causes stress. Melatonin is as effective as other drugs used to decrease anxiety prior to surgery, like the benzodiazepine drugs like alprazolam and Oxazepam.

Melatonin is also proven to be beneficial in treating sarcoidosis. Initial research suggests that it can help with conditions such as anxiety, depression, and pulmonary fibrosis. Melatonin, a naturally occurring antioxidant, can protect the body against the damage caused by oxidative stress.

Melatonin for anxiety treatment is best as part of a holistic treatment plan. Integrating it into a healthy life style, like regular exercise and meditative practices, and eating a diet high in whole foods can significantly increase its effectiveness against anxiety symptoms.

While melatonin can be consumed at any time of the day, it is usually taken before bedtime, since it plays a significant role in regulating the sleep-wake cycle. Based on your age, weight and sensitivity to melatonin you can start with a small dose of 1 to 3 mg and gradually increase the dosage over time. Some people are able to tolerate higher doses, but they may be afflicted by side effects such as insomnia, vivid dreams and nightmares. To avoid side effects, start with a low dose and gradually increase it.
